Function Description In summary, a PSMG3?AS1?miR?143?3p?COL1A1 regula?tory axis in breast cancer was indicated in the present study. PSMG3?AS1 served as an oncogenic lncRNA that facilitated the genesis and development of breast cancer, by functioning as a ceRNA, which regulated the expression of COL1A1, and also through directly sponging miR?143?3p. In the present study, PSMG3?AS1 was indicated to be a new potential thera?peutic target in breast carcinoma treatment. Invivo studies have revealed the important role of lncRNAs and miRNAs in tumors. For example, H19 was revealed to be associated with tumor development, progression, metastasis and drug resistance (41), and silencing of MALAT1 suppressed the proliferation of GSCs and invivo tumor growth by upregulating miR?129 and inhibiting SOX2 (42)
